Investing in the Future

February 12, 2009 - 10:12pm — Abigail

The recent presidential election and Obama’s inauguration will go down in the history books for numerous reasons. It touched so many people in so many different ways. Personally, I was able to see how it empowered and transformed children where I work and children where I tutor. As predominately inner city children, they were able to find inspiration and a voice in Obama and his message. These children are now engaged in their communities and are invested in their future. I don’t know what the next 4, 8, 20 years hold for our country and our world. I believe a key ensuring that but a key to it is having all of our children invested in the future. So far from the inner city kids have talked to, this president has been able to do just that.
